The Story

Sirena brings Oceania Cruises' signature style of destination-focused ocean cruising to travelers who appreciate a more intimate ship experience. This elegant vessel carries guests to ports around the world, combining the refined amenities Oceania is known for with the warm atmosphere of a smaller ship.

Originally built in 1999 and joining the Oceania fleet in 2016 after extensive renovations, Sirena accommodates 684 guests and features the cruise line's acclaimed culinary program with multiple specialty restaurants. The ship maintains Oceania's country club casual ambiance, where formal nights give way to relaxed elegance and the focus remains squarely on the destinations. Guests enjoy spacious public areas, attentive service, and the line's commitment to gourmet dining experiences at sea.

Sirena operates a variety of ocean itineraries spanning the globe, from Mediterranean voyages exploring historic ports to transoceanic crossings and exotic destinations throughout Asia, Africa, and the South Pacific. The ship's size allows access to smaller ports that larger vessels cannot reach, while still providing the stability and amenities expected on ocean crossings. Whether you're drawn to cultural immersion in European cities, island-hopping in the Caribbean, or extended explorations of remote coastlines, Sirena delivers Oceania's destination-rich approach to ocean cruising.

Questions

Sirena accommodates 684 guests, making it one of Oceania's smaller ships. This intimate size creates a more personalized cruising experience while still offering the amenities and stability of an ocean-going vessel.
Sirena features Oceania's renowned culinary program with multiple dining venues including specialty restaurants. The ship maintains the cruise line's commitment to gourmet cuisine with options ranging from French-inspired fare to Italian and Asian specialties, most included in your fare.
Sirena follows Oceania's country club casual dress code, which is more relaxed than traditional cruise formality. There are no formal nights required, though elegant casual attire is suggested for evening dining in the main restaurants.
Sirena operates worldwide ocean itineraries including the Mediterranean, Caribbean, Asia, Africa, and South Pacific. The ship's size allows it to visit both popular ports and smaller destinations that larger vessels cannot access during its global deployment.
Sirena joined Oceania Cruises in 2016 after undergoing extensive renovations. Originally built in 1999, the ship was refurbished to match Oceania's standards and design aesthetic before beginning service with the fleet.
Beyond the fare

What Oceania Cruises actually costs

These rates apply fleetwide across Oceania Cruises.

Verified July 2026
Gratuities are included in the fare

Unlike most mainstream lines, Oceania Cruises folds crew gratuities into the ticket price — so a fare that looks expensive next to a budget line may not be.

Eliminated the automatic gratuity in 2025; crew gratuities are now included in the base fare.
